You'll need to sign up at Reviews.co.uk or Reviews.io to use this plugin.
Via command line, cd
to Magento2 root folder
As this plugin is hosted on packagist.org, you simply use the following to instruct composer to fetch and install the module:
composer require reviewscouk/reviews:0.0.8a
When this is complete, cd
to /bin
and run the following:
./magento module:enable Reviewscouk_Reviews --clear-static-content
./magento setup:upgrade
This extension requires a Store ID and an API key, obtained from your account area on Reviews.co.uk or Reviews.io. To find these details;
Company Setup -> Publish Reviews
To configure the module, log into your Magento Administration panel (ensuring the module is correctly installed) and then;
Stores -> Configuration -> Reviews.co.uk -> Setup
The Reviews Magento extension offers a number of features - which ones you use will depend on what you're looking to achieve. Below is in a brief outline of them all, and instruction on how to configure them.
Magento can automate the review collection process by sending customer/order data to the Reviews platform as soon as an order is completed. You can control the automated collection of Merchant and Product reviews independently by;
Stores -> Configuration -> Reviews.co.uk -> Automation -> Review Collection
The product feed allows you to sync your product catalog with the Reviews platform. This feed will be available at www.your-domain.com/reviews/index/feed. To enable this;
Stores -> Configuration -> Reviews.co.uk -> Automation -> Product Feed
Automatically pull through product specific reviews directly onto your product pages. To enable this;
Stores -> Configuration -> Reviews.co.uk -> On Page Content -> Product Reviews Widget
The Reviews.co.uk Magento modules allows you to automatically include structured Rich Snippet data on your pages. This data is used by search engines to better understand the content of your pages. Search engines also often use this data to improve the content of results on a Search Engine Result Page (SERP). You can find out more information here
To enable Rich Snippets;
Stores -> Configuration -> Reviews.co.uk -> On Page Content -> Rich Snippets
